FIFA U – 17 WC: Colombia Beat Nigeria in Penalties

Nigeria’s U-17 women’s national team, Flamingoes lost to Colombia in the semi-final of the ongoing FIFA U-17 Women’s World Cup in India.

The game ended goalless after regulation time then Colombia defeated the Nigeria 5-6 on penalties to grab their ticket for Sunday’s final.

The third-place match on Sunday will be between Nigeria and the Germans who had lost 1-0 to defending champions Spain.

It is the second time Nigeria will play Germany in the competition. In their first meeting in the group stage the Germans came from a goal down to beat the Flamingos 2-1.
